St. Xavier’s Win Four Medals at Indo-Nepal Karate Championship

News reported by: Fr. Babu Stephen SDB
St. Xavier’s Higher Secondary School, Pathaliaghat, added another milestone to its sporting achievements as two of its students, Ms Jina Debbarma and Master James Jamatia, excelled at the prestigious President Cup 12th Indo-Nepal Karate Championship 2026 held at Mechinagar-6, Kakarvitta, Jhapa, Nepal, from August 22 to 23, winning four medals in all.
 
Organised by the Nepal Shito Ryu Karate School, the international championship brought together karatekas from different places to compete in various events.
 
Jina Debbarma delivered an impressive performance, securing the gold medal in the Kata event. She continued her winning run in the Kumite event in the under-32 kg category, claiming the silver medal. Master James Jamatia also put up a commendable performance, winning the bronze medal in Kata. In the Kumite event in the 64 kg category, he secured a silver medal and a certificate.
 
The school expressed appreciation to Karate Master Mr Indison Debbarma for his dedicated training, guidance and tireless efforts in preparing the students for the international championship. His coaching, encouragement and commitment were instrumental in shaping the success of the young champions.
